Output cd37e79362de63cd86b5f9e4b34d263ecf257aee6ea3960e25dea203eda9116e:0

value
77729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b6673fc57ae91ca65269f50450df6d7134cb63 OP_EQUAL
address
34DYgKy1aYKByhgim5WsQSfU82oABaDENe
transaction
cd37e79362de63cd86b5f9e4b34d263ecf257aee6ea3960e25dea203eda9116e
confirmations
3080
spent
true